1. Post-It Note dash car upgrade

post it note dash car upgrade

While this isn’t necessarily a true QOL upgrade, it looks super cool, and sometimes that’s all you need to give you a little boost on your morning commute. Adding a rainbow (or whatever color) effect to your dash lights couldn’t be easier. Simply arrange your desired Post-It notes behind the cover and voilà. 

2. Transform your cup holders with cupcake liners

cupholder car upgrades

Everybody knows that cup holders are basically catch-alls for keys, drinks, phones, and also tons of crumbs and other debris. And unfortunately when they’re dirty, they’re super hard to clean. Keep that from happening in the first place by placing silicone cupcake liners in each cup holder!

3. Keep your floor tidy with a carabiner 

Hate to mess up your spotless car floor? Simply use a couple of carabiners to create headrest hooks for anything from a trash collector or snack carrier. 

4. DIY drink/milkshake tray car upgrades

DIY car upgrades

This one’s great if you have kids or regularly go out with friends. The drink trays they tend to give out at fast-food restaurants are pretty flimsy, so DIY one yourself with just a small basket and a muffin tin. 

5. Make grocery day easier with laundry baskets

trunk grocery bin car upgrades

Carrying your groceries back into your house can be a struggle, especially if you live in an apartment. Make it easier on yourself by keeping a shallow laundry basket or two in your trunk to place grocery bags in. 

6. Organize your glove box

A lot of us just stash all of our important documents in a pile inside our glove box, but then when we need to find something quickly, we’re out of luck. Instead, invest in a little glovebox book to keep everything organized, or make one yourself with a couple of folders and dividers.

7. Car upgrades to keep your windshield from fogging up

Okay, we doubt you’ve ever heard of this QOL car upgrade before, but it’s true – keeping a sock filled with kitty litter on your dash will help keep your windshield from fogging up. Crazy, but true.
